diff options
Diffstat (limited to 'chrome/common/message_router.cc')
-rw-r--r-- | chrome/common/message_router.cc |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/chrome/common/message_router.cc b/chrome/common/message_router.cc index 4b0703e..b73f2d0 100644 --- a/chrome/common/message_router.cc +++ b/chrome/common/message_router.cc @@ -33,10 +33,14 @@ void MessageRouter::OnMessageReceived(const IPC::Message& msg) { } bool MessageRouter::RouteMessage(const IPC::Message& msg) { - IPC::Channel::Listener* listener = routes_.Lookup(msg.routing_id()); + IPC::Channel::Listener* listener = ResolveRoute(msg.routing_id()); if (!listener) return false; listener->OnMessageReceived(msg); return true; } + +IPC::Channel::Listener* MessageRouter::ResolveRoute(int32 routing_id) { + return routes_.Lookup(routing_id); +} |